ICAS 13: UNAIR Rector Encourages Collaboration with Global Partners Monday, 05 August 2024 11:23

UNAIR NEWS - Networking Dinner 13th International Convention of Asian Scholars (ICAS 13) also completed a series of events on the fourth day of ICAS 13. The event took place in Amerta Room 4th Floor, MEER-C Campus Management Office on Wednesday (31/7/2024).

Present at the event were Prof. Dr. Mohammad Nasih SE MT Ak as Rector of Universitas Airlangga (UNAIR), Prof. Philippe Peycam as Director of the International Institute for Asian Studies (IIAS), and Dr. Lina Puryanti SS MHum Phd as Director of Airlangga Indian Ocean Crossroads (AIIOC).

In his speech, Prof. Nasih expressed his gratitude for trusting UNAIR as the host of the largest conference event in Asia. He hoped that UNAIR would provide benefits and valuable memories for ICAS 13 participants.

"We are happy for the arrival of ICAS 13 participants from 66 countries to UNAIR. Hopefully, this ICAS event can open academic opportunities for the participants and leave good impressions and memories for ICAS 13 participants, "added Prof. Nasih.

 

Important Role
As one of the best universities in Indonesia, UNAIR continues to be dedicated to improving and advancing the benefits of science for the community through education, research, and service. In addition, universities also have a role to create innovations and solutions to global problems.

"In this case, UNAIR does not only focus on the development of health, natural, social and humanitarian sciences. However, it also collaborates on global problems and challenges that occur today, "said the Professor of Faculty of Economics and Business UNAIR.

UNAIR collaborates with approximately 5000 active partnerships abroad to collaborate and exchange ideas and new knowledge. UNAIR also provides various mobility programs for UNAIR academicians.

"We are very open to proposals for academic mobility programs for academicians, both for research, publications, and community service. UNAIR will

provide funding scheme support facilities for these programs," he explained.

 

Potential Collaboration
UNAIR also has potential units that are ready to collaborate with outside parties, such as the Institute of Tropical Diseases (LPT), Stem Cell Research and Development Center, Biomolecular Engineering Research Center (BIOME), Research Center for Global Infectious Diseases (RC-GERID), Patient Safety Research Center, SDGs Center, Center for Environmental, Social and Governance Studies (CESGS), Halal Center, and Airlangga Indian Ocean Crossroads (AIIOC).

Prof. Nasih added that the ICAS 13 event can open opportunities for sustainable collaboration with units that are already available at UNAIR. By making connections and collaborating together, it is hoped that mutual benefits can be achieved for the global community.

 

Testimonial
Laura Elber, a representative of the International Institute for Asian Studies (IIAS) gave appreciation to UNAIR as the host of ICAS 13. UNAIR has packaged the ICAS 13 event well. Therefore, ICAS 13 provided an unforgettable memory for Laura.

"I really enjoyed the ICAS 13 event. This is my first time visiting Surabaya. The city of Surabaya is so beautiful and has many cultures and historical stories that are very interesting to learn, especially the villages in Surabaya," Laura said in an exclusive interview with the UNAIR NEWS Team.

Laura explained that the concept of conference festival (Confes) was the first time used at the ICAS event. Through this concept, ICAS 13 is not only an academic conference, but also provides experience for participants to interact and get closer to the surrounding community and society.
